About

Weikel's is a legendary stop for travelers, famous for its authentic Czech kolaches and fresh bread. While most visitors rave about the quality of the pastries and sandwiches, there are consistent complaints about rude service and high prices. Despite the service issues, it remains a must-visit destination for many on the road between Austin and Houston.
